DRW is a technology-driven, diversified principal trading firm. We trade our own capital at our own risk, across a broad range of asset classes, instruments and strategies, in financial markets around the world. As the markets have evolved over the past 25 years, so has DRW – maximizing opportunities to include real estate, cryptoassets and venture capital. With over 1000 employees at our Chicago headquarters and offices around the world, we work together to solve complex problems, challenge consensus and deliver meaningful results. As a recognized sourcing and negotiations expert, you will lead sourcing strategies across multiple categories including hardware, software, and data licensing, as well as lead contract and pricing negotiations. You will help manage budgets with business stakeholders and provide executive summaries to business leaders. You will liaise with a variety of internal teams to understand their business needs and work to maximize the value of the products and services acquired.
Responsibilities:
- Lead negotiations for the acquisition of assets and services globally
- Guide and shape vendor relationships, including evaluating new suppliers with a focus on developing strategic partnerships
- Develop competitive sourcing and negotiation strategies and implement best-practices across the firm
- Drive vendor performance management including establishing and measuring KPIs; conduct regular business reviews
- Train and coach procurement team and business leads on successful negotiation strategies and tactics specific to our needs
- Perform detailed review of IT infrastructure hardware and software BOMs (bill of materials) and quotes
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ders to gather requirements and make recommendations
- Analyze spend to identify patterns and opportunities across asset categories to reduce total cost or increase value
- Proactively anticipate supply risks and communicate them to the business
- Facilitate the complete requisition and PO process, including application of our cost allocation methodologies
